Transactions on Petri Nets and Other Models of Concurrency III

Author:   Kurt Jensen ,  Jonathan Billington ,  Maciej Koutny
Publisher:   Springer-Verlag Berlin and Heidelberg GmbH & Co. KG
Edition:   2009 ed.
Volume:   5800
ISBN:  

9783642048548


Pages:   275
Publication Date:   11 November 2009
Format:   Paperback
Availability:   In Print   Availability explained
This item will be ordered in for you from one of our suppliers. Upon receipt, we will promptly dispatch it out to you. For in store availability, please contact us.

Our Price $258.72 Quantity:  
Add to Cart

Share |

Transactions on Petri Nets and Other Models of Concurrency III


Add your own review!

Overview

AccordingtoHolzmann [14], protocol speci?cationscomprise ?veelements: the service the protocol provides toits users; the set of messages that are exchanged between protocol entities; the format of each message; the rules governingm- sage exchange (procedures); and the assumptionsabout the environment in which the protocol is intended tooperate. In protocol standards documents, information related to the operatingenvironment isusually writteninformally andmayoccur in several di?erentplaces [37]. This informal speci?cation style canlead to misunderstandings andpossibly incompatible implementations. In contrast,executableformalmodelsrequireprecisespeci?cations oftheoperating environment. Ofparticularsigni?canceisthecommunicationmediumorchannel over which the protocol operates. Channelscan havedi?erent characteristics depending on the physical media (e. g. optical ?bre, copper, cable orunguided media (radio)) they employ. The characteristics also depend on the levelof the protocol inacomputer protocol architecture. Forexample, the link-leveloperates over a singlemedium,whereas the network, transport andapplication levelsmayoperate over a network,or network of networks such as the Internet,which couldemploy several di?erent physical media. Channels (such as satellite links) can be noisy resulting in bit errors in packets. To correct biterrors in packets, many importantprotocols (such the Internet's TransmissionControl Protocol [27]) use CyclicRedundancy Checks (CRCs)[28] to detect errors. On detectingan error,the receiver discards the packet andrelies on the sender to retransmit itforrecovery,known as Au- maticRepeatreQuest(ARQ)[28]. Thisisachievedbythereceiveracknowledging the receipt of good packets, andby the transmitter maintainingatimer. When the timer expires before an acknowledgementhasbeen received, the transmitter retransmits packets that havebeen sent but are as yet notacknowledged. It may also be possibleforpacketsto be lost due to routers in networks discarding packets when congested.

Full Product Details

Author:   Kurt Jensen ,  Jonathan Billington ,  Maciej Koutny
Publisher:   Springer-Verlag Berlin and Heidelberg GmbH & Co. KG
Imprint:   Springer-Verlag Berlin and Heidelberg GmbH & Co. K
Edition:   2009 ed.
Volume:   5800
Dimensions:   Width: 15.50cm , Height: 1.50cm , Length: 23.50cm
Weight:   0.456kg
ISBN:  

9783642048548


ISBN 10:   3642048544
Pages:   275
Publication Date:   11 November 2009
Audience:   Professional and scholarly ,  Professional & Vocational
Format:   Paperback
Publisher's Status:   Active
Availability:   In Print   Availability explained
This item will be ordered in for you from one of our suppliers. Upon receipt, we will promptly dispatch it out to you. For in store availability, please contact us.

Table of Contents

Designing a Workflow System Using Coloured Petri Nets.- From Requirements via Colored Workflow Nets to an Implementation in Several Workflow Systems.- Soundness of Workflow Nets with Reset Arcs.- Parameterised Coloured Petri Net Channel Models.- On Modelling and Analysing the Dynamic MANET On-Demand (DYMO) Routing Protocol.- Modelling Mobile IP with Mobile Petri Nets.- A Discretization Method from Coloured to Symmetric Nets: Application to an Industrial Example.- The ComBack Method Revisited: Caching Strategies and Extension with Delayed Duplicate Detection.- Comparison of Different Algorithms to Synthesize a Petri Net from a Partial Language.- On Bisimulation Theory in Linear Higher-Order ?-Calculus.

Reviews

Author Information

Tab Content 6

Author Website:  

Customer Reviews

Recent Reviews

No review item found!

Add your own review!

Countries Available

All regions
Latest Reading Guide

lgn

al

Shopping Cart
Your cart is empty
Shopping cart
Mailing List